Corporate Controller

Everwood Hospitality Partners - Indianapolis, IN

Apply Now

Job Description

Come join our team! Everwood is a fast-growing hospitality management company that takes pride in creating memorable experiences for our associates, guests, ownership, and our communities. We are looking for a dynamic individual with accounting experience for our Carmel corporate office. Hotel accounting experience is a must. Benefits include: -Bonus Plan -Great starting rate and flexible scheduling -Vision / Dental / Medical / Life Insurances -Up to 15 PTO Days in the first year -Hotel Discounts Job Type: Full-time Pay: Negotiable DOE Required: -Min 5-years Hotel Accounting -Bachelors in Accounting -Proficiency of M3,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, and PDF programs -Must have management experience overseeing accounting team and operations Job Description: The Corporate Controller will work closely with senior property level and corporate level management. They must be able to facilitate efficient communication across an entire portfolio. The candidate is responsible for overseeing all of the accounts payables for the hotels and administrative office duties and special projects/tasks while fostering a positive work environment. The ideal candidate will be even tempered with strong accounting, interpersonal skills, organizational skills as well as written and verbal communication skills. Responsibilities: The ideal candidate will be responsible for performing the following tasks to the highest of standards for a fluctuating number of hotels in the portfolio. Accounting: -Ensure that all invoices are reviewed and processed accurately and in a timely manner, meeting all discount and payment deadlines. -Understand, manage, and generate the weekly check run payments to vendors. -Respond to vendor or internal inquiries and research to resolve concerns or discrepancies. -Prepare and post accounting documents including but not limited to requisitions, expense reports, and general expenses. -Reconcile vendor statements routinely and maintain vendor master files. -Maintain detailed and complete records. -Assist with month end closing ensuring invoices are processed within the month received. -Report on the status of accounts payable -Execute all day-to-day banking needs and deposits. -Bank reconciliations, credit card reconciliations -Contract Maintenance (license renewals) -Perform other required tasks as assigned. Administrative: -Arranging staff meetings and scheduling appointments. -Answering or transferring phone calls and taking messages for select staff members -Maintaining the office calendar. -Writing memos, correspondence, invoices, receipts, spreadsheets and other reports as needed. -Keeping the office database and filing system up to date and organized. -Purchasing office supplies. -Working with office equipment vendors to purchase and maintain office equipment such as printers and fax machines -Sorting and delivering all mail and faxes -Clean / sanitize office as needed -Miscellaneous Administrative Tasks Requirements: -Proven work experience as a Hotel Controller -Good knowledge of bookkeeping procedures -Hands-on experience with accounting software preferred -Excellent proficiency of M3,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, and PDF programs. -Solid data entry skills with an ability to identify numerical errors -Good organizational and time-management abilities -High school diploma or equivalent required; Associate''s or bachelor''s degree in accounting required. -Strong attention to detail and organization required, ability to adapt to change and effectively multi-task. -Ability to perform work accurately and thoroughly with limited supervision. -Excellent interpersonal skills with the ability to communicate with all levels of staff. -Ability to convey information effectively and clearly both in both verbal and written form. -Ability to be internally inspired to perform a task to the best of one''s ability using his or her own drive or initiative. -Must be reliable, responsible, dependable, and fulfilling of obligations.
